What Type of Medicine is Respibien (Oxymetazoline)?

Respibien is an over-the-counter (OTC) pharmaceutical preparation whose fundamental identity is defined by its active ingredient, Oxymetazoline hydrochloride. This compound is a synthetic substance, clinically recognized for its vasoconstrictive properties, and is classified as a sympathomimetic agent and an Adrenergic alpha-Agonist. Its scientific classification confirms that this medicine works by interacting with the body's natural signaling pathways to achieve a local effect. This product is positioned primarily for the adult and adolescent patient group seeking reliable relief.

Composition and Formulation: The Nasal Decongestant Type

The medication is formulated as an aqueous nasal solution, intended for topical intranasal administration via a nasal spray or drops. This specific dosage form ensures that the Oxymetazoline is applied directly to the nasal lining. The preparation is typically a single-ingredient product, containing only the decongestant, distinguishing it from combination medications, although formulations for specialized needs, such as a Freshmint variant, are available. The aqueous base is essential for distributing the medicine across the nasal mucosa effectively.

What is the General Purpose of This Preparation?

The general purpose of Respibien is to function as a nasal decongestant, providing local relief from acute symptoms such as a stuffy nose often experienced during a common cold. This benefit is fundamentally achieved through the physiological action of Oxymetazoline as a potent vasoconstrictor. Pharmacological properties support the medication's ability to quickly and substantially reduce blood flow and subsequent swelling. By causing the blood vessels beneath the nasal mucosa to contract, the preparation promotes the diminished swelling of the mucosa, which in turn restores the natural potency of the airway.

What side effects are possible with Respibien?

Possible Side Effects and Safety Information

The safety profile for Oxymetazoline hydrochloride (Respibien) is characterized by both local administration site reactions and a rare risk of systemic effects, as documented in official regulatory classifications. The risk profile is highly dependent on the duration of use and the amount absorbed.


Frequency-Classified Adverse Reactions

The most common adverse reactions affect the nasal passages. According to regulatory frequency standards, the following are listed:

  • Uncommon (affecting up to 1 in 100 people): Sneezing, dryness, and irritation in the nose, mouth, and throat.
  • Rare (affecting up to 1 in 1,000 people): Systemic effects impacting the Cardiac and Vascular disorders (e.g., tachycardia, palpitations, increased blood pressure) and Nervous system disorders (e.g., anxiety, headache, sleep disorders, irritability).

Safety Patterns and Constraints

A critical safety note is related to duration of exposure. Use for longer than the recommended short period is officially associated with rebound congestion (Rhinitis Medicamentosa), a drug-induced swelling of the nasal lining, and an increased risk of systemic side effects.

Serious adverse reactions following overdose or accidental ingestion, particularly in young children, may include cardiac arrhythmia, severe hypertension, and loss of consciousness. Furthermore, official labeling advises caution in patients with pre-existing conditions such as hypertension, cardiac disease, hyperthyroidism, and diabetes mellitus, as these groups are considered more susceptible to systemic absorption effects.

Overdose and Emergency Response

Overdose and when to seek help

The official regulatory profile for Oxymetazoline (Respibien) overdose documents a serious, potentially life-threatening pattern of physiological disturbances, primarily affecting the Central Nervous System (CNS) and the cardiovascular system.

Documented Manifestations and Severe Outcomes An overdose may initially present with signs of CNS excitement, such as anxiety, restlessness, tremor, and headache, before progressing to severe CNS depression, which includes lethargy, stupor, and coma. Cardiovascular manifestations are documented to include both high (hypertension) and dangerously low (hypotension) blood pressure, alongside severe heart rate irregularities such as tachycardia and bradycardia. Loss of consciousness, cardiac failure, and apnoea (stopped breathing) are listed as severe, life-threatening complications.

Required Emergency Actions Official government guidance mandates that individuals must seek emergency medical care immediately upon suspicion of an overdose or accidental ingestion. The regulatory documentation requires hospitalization for serious adverse events. No specific antidote is known for Oxymetazoline; therefore, treatment is limited to symptomatic and supportive management, and the use of vasopressor drugs is contraindicated.

Specific Consideration for Children Regulatory warnings emphasize that young children (5 years and under) are a highly vulnerable population. Accidental oral ingestion of even a small volume is officially documented to cause life-threatening symptoms, including severe cardiovascular effects and CNS depression, requiring urgent attention.

Eligibility and Restrictions for Use

The eligibility for using Respibien (Oxymetazoline hydrochloride nasal solution) is strictly governed by official regulatory labeling regarding age, pre-existing health conditions, and drug history.

Eligibility Scope

Classification Eligibility Rule Restriction Context
Allowed Use Adults and adolescents 6 years of age and older (for 0.05% solutions). Use in the elderly is permitted, with no mandated dosage reduction in regulatory documents.
Contraindicated Patients with known hypersensitivity to oxymetazoline or any formulation ingredient. Use is prohibited in patients taking Monoamine Oxidase Inhibitors (MAOIs) or within 14 days of stopping MAOI treatment.
Conditional Use Patients with certain systemic conditions must consult a health professional. Conditions include high blood pressure (hypertension), heart disease (including acute coronary disease), diabetes mellitus, hyperthyroidism, and narrow-angle glaucoma.
Age Restriction Children under 6 years of age are not recommended for self-medication and require medical consultation. Safety and effectiveness have not been established in the youngest pediatric group.
Reproductive Status Use requires consulting a health professional. Safety during pregnancy has not been established, and caution is advised for nursing women.

What should I know about interactions with other medicines?

Interactions with other medicines and products

The official regulatory profile for Oxymetazoline primarily focuses on pharmacodynamic interactions related to its function as an alpha-adrenergic agonist, with restrictions placed on combining it with other medicines that affect the cardiovascular or nervous system.


Documented Interaction Patterns

Category Documented Interaction Entities and Outcomes
Prohibited Combinations Monoamine Oxidase Inhibitors (MAOIs): Use is prohibited if the patient is taking or has stopped an MAOI (e.g., Isocarboxazid, Phenelzine) within the preceding 14 days. This is due to the risk of severe pressor effects and resulting hypertension.
Pharmacodynamic Reinforcement Tricyclic Antidepressants (TCAs): Co-administration with TCAs (e.g., Amitriptyline) or nonselective Beta-adrenergic Antagonists is not recommended due to the potential for additive sympathomimetic effects and increased risk of hypertension.
Functional Restriction Other Intranasal Products: Simultaneous use is restricted, as Oxymetazoline may slow the rate of absorption of the co-administered intranasal medicine.
Cardiovascular Interference Caution is advised when used with Anti-hypertensives, Cardiac Glycosides, or other Beta-adrenergic agents, as Oxymetazoline’s vasoconstrictive action may interfere with their intended effects.
Metabolic Risk Official data indicates Oxymetazoline is minimally metabolized by liver enzymes, suggesting a low potential for clinically significant pharmacokinetic interactions via CYP enzyme pathways.

Administration Requirements

Formal regulatory documentation requires a mandatory 14-day washout period after stopping an MAOI before using this product. There are no known formal interactions documented in the labeling with food, alcohol, or herbal products.

Mechanism of Action

The mechanism of action for Respibien is based on the drug's role as a direct modulator of the sympathetic nervous system's control over local blood vessels, initiating a physical process that reduces tissue volume. The drug covers the molecular interaction of Oxymetazoline with the alpha-1 (alpha1) and alpha-2 (alpha2) adrenergic receptors on the blood vessels in the nasal lining. By acting as an agonist, the drug mimics the body's natural signaling molecules, forcing the vascular smooth muscle to contract and triggering the subsequent physiological consequence of vasoconstriction.

The contraction of the blood vessels, known as vasoconstriction, significantly reduces blood flow and pressure in the mucosal tissues. This reduction in local pressure results in the inhibition of fluid exudation into the tissue, leading to a decrease in mucosal tissue volume.

Continuous receptor activation leads to tachyphylaxis (reduced efficacy) due to the alpha-adrenoceptors becoming desensitized and down-regulated. Moreover, the sustained vasoconstriction can lead to a compensatory, reactive vasodilation upon drug clearance, which is the underlying cause of a sustained, reactive vasodilation (hyperemia).

Dosage and Administration Information

Official Administration Guidelines

Respibien nasal spray is strictly for nasal administration. Adherence to the specific dosing schedule and duration is mandatory to ensure appropriate use.


Administration Scope Official Instruction
Route Nasal (spray)
Dosing (Adults ge 12 Years) 1 spray in each nostril
Frequency No more than 2 applications in 24 hours
Maximum Duration 3 consecutive days
Age Restriction Not for use in children under 12 years of age

Procedural Steps

Specific steps for preparing and applying the medicine include:

  1. Preparation: Before the first use, or if the product has not been used for some time, the spray must be primed by pressing the pump repeatedly while pointing it away from the body until a fine liquid mist is released.
  2. Application: The nose must be thoroughly cleaned (e.g., by blowing the nose) before applying the medicine. Insert the nozzle into the nostril, make one quick, firm press, and inhale deeply while spraying.
  3. Hygiene: To prevent the spread of infection, the container should only be used by one person. After each application, the end of the applicator must be wiped with a clean, damp cloth before closing the container immediately.

If symptoms worsen or do not improve after 3 days of continuous treatment, use must be discontinued.

Recent Clinical Evidence

Evidence for Temporary Relief of Nasal Congestion

The body of research examined use in conditions characterized by acute, temporary nasal congestion. These investigations are primarily characterized by short-term, randomized, double-blind trials which compared the product against a neutral placebo. These studies assessing episodic symptom patterns were observed in primarily adult and adolescent populations.

Outcomes Measured in Clinical Trials

Research examined both subjective data (patient-reported discomfort) and objective data (measurements of nasal airflow and resistance). Systematic reviews describe patterns observed in the studies regarding patterns of change in objective airflow compared to placebo throughout the short-term monitoring period (up to 12 hours).

Understanding Follow-up and Duration of Study

The research landscape covers studies monitored over short-term intervals, typically up to 12 hours. Other trials explored repeated-dosing protocols, with observation periods extending over 3 to 10 days, and in some cases, up to four weeks. Longer studies data show patterns related to changes in baseline nasal function over continuous application.

Research on Prolonged Use and Tolerability

Research was evaluated in settings designed to explore use patterns extending beyond short-term recommendations. Findings were mixed across various studies investigating rebound congestion or rhinitis medicamentosa. Research describes that the factors influencing the return of symptoms are not fully established, and some studies suggest the role of the preservative may require further characterization.

Research Evidence in Subgroups

The majority of clinical studies were observed in a general population of healthy adults and adolescents. Evidence is limited for specific older adult populations, individuals with certain pre-existing chronic health conditions, or groups where symptoms may vary in intensity. Research provides context for the specific populations studied.

What Research Gaps and Uncertainties Remain

The research provides context on short-term symptom patterns but highlights areas where certainty remains low. Long-term effects are not fully established, as follow-up durations were limited in most trials. There is a scarcity of data for long-term outcomes. The evidence describes symptom patterns, but research does not determine whether an individual will respond similarly.

Frequently Asked Questions (FAQ)

Common questions about Respibien (FAQ)

Q: How is Respibien different from other common nasal sprays?

A: According to the official classification, the active ingredient in Respibien is an alpha-Agonist and a sympathomimetic agent. This means it works directly by constricting the blood vessels inside the nose to physically reduce swelling. This mechanism is different from how nasal sprays containing steroids (which reduce inflammation) or antihistamines (which block allergy responses) typically function.

Q: Can Respibien be used for allergies?

A: Official regulatory information indicates that this medicine is used for the temporary relief of nasal congestion. This includes congestion caused by common conditions like the cold or sinus issues, as well as those stemming from hay fever or other common allergies.

Q: How quickly should Respibien start working after I use it?

A: Regulatory documents describe that the medicine’s effect begins quite quickly. The onset of action is typically observed within minutes after the product is applied to the nose.

Q: Is it possible to develop a tolerance to Respibien over time?

A: Studies and official information on how the product works describe a process called tachyphylaxis, which is essentially a reduced response to the drug. With continuous use, the blood vessels may become less sensitive to the medicine, which may be associated with a reduced effect over time.

Q: What does the official documentation say about long-term use of Respibien?

A: Official regulatory guidance limits the duration of continuous use to a short period, typically 3 to 7 consecutive days. This is because prolonged use is officially associated with an increased risk of developing rebound congestion, or Rhinitis Medicamentosa, and may be associated with an increased potential for systemic side effects.

Q: Does Respibien cause a dry mouth or throat?

A: According to the official safety profile, dryness and irritation in the nose, mouth, and throat are listed as an uncommon adverse reaction. This means it affects up to 1 in 100 people who use the product.

Q: Why do regulatory agencies sometimes advise against prolonged use of decongestant sprays?

A: Regulatory agencies advise against prolonged use, typically longer than 3 to 7 days, due to the risk of developing rebound congestion. This condition, also known as Rhinitis Medicamentosa, is a drug-induced swelling of the nasal lining that often worsens symptoms, and may be associated with an increased chance of systemic absorption effects.

Q: What is the main difference between Respibien and a product containing oxymetazoline?

A: Respibien is the brand name of a product whose only active ingredient is Oxymetazoline hydrochloride. The medicine itself is defined by the active ingredient. The main differences between various products containing Oxymetazoline are usually the brand name, cost, or the inactive ingredients used in the formulation.

Q: Is Respibien available over the counter or does it require a prescription?

A: The medicine containing Oxymetazoline nasal solution is generally classified as an over-the-counter (OTC) pharmaceutical product. It is intended for the temporary and local relief of nasal congestion without needing a prescription.

Q: Is it normal to feel a stinging sensation after using Respibien?

A: Yes, official regulatory information lists common adverse reactions which can include a temporary stinging or burning sensation in the nose right after the spray is used. This is generally considered a local and short-lived effect of the application.

Q: Are there any major food or drink interactions with Respibien?

A: According to the formal regulatory documentation for the medicine, there are no known formal interactions specifically documented in the labeling regarding food or alcohol.

Q: Can Respibien be used by children?

A: Official guidelines state that the standard 0.05% solution is indicated for use in adults and children 6 years of age and older. Use in children under 6 years of age requires specific determination by a health professional.

Q: Is Respibien suitable for elderly patients?

A: Official regulatory documents state there is no mandated dosage reduction needed for elderly patients. However, caution is advised in official labeling, as older patients may have an increased susceptibility to the systemic effects of the medicine.

Q: Can Respibien cause sleeplessness or insomnia?

A: Yes, regulatory documents list effects on the nervous system as a rare adverse reaction, meaning it affects up to 1 in 1,000 people. These effects include sleep disorders (such as sleeplessness or insomnia), anxiety, and irritability.

Q: Is Respibien safe to use while breastfeeding?

A: Official labeling advises caution for nursing women because the safety of use during lactation has not been fully established. Due to the medicine's local application and limited systemic absorption, some authorities indicate it is often considered over oral decongestants.

Q: Does Respibien contain any antihistamines?

A: The product is typically a single-ingredient preparation whose active component is Oxymetazoline hydrochloride, which is a decongestant. It is classified as an alpha-Agonist and does not contain an antihistamine ingredient.

Q: Is the component in Respibien found in other medicines?

A: Yes, the active component, Oxymetazoline, is used in many other products. It is the main ingredient in other over-the-counter nasal decongestant sprays, and it is also found in some prescription eye drops and topical creams used for other medical conditions.

Q: What should I know about the safety profile of Respibien?

A: The official safety profile emphasizes that the medicine is generally safe when used for the recommended short period (maximum 3 to 7 days). Key constraints include the risk of rebound congestion with overuse and the need for caution in patients with pre-existing conditions like high blood pressure, heart disease, diabetes, or hyperthyroidism.

Q: Is Respibien a habit-forming substance?

A: While the medicine is not classified as a controlled substance, official information links continuous use to the physical condition of rebound congestion (Rhinitis Medicamentosa). Because rebound congestion causes symptoms to worsen after stopping the drug, some users may feel a continuous need to use the product to maintain clear breathing.

Q: What information is publicly available about how the medicine is metabolized?

A: According to official information, the product is minimally metabolized by the body's liver enzymes. With typical local nasal use, there is generally very limited systemic absorption of the active ingredient into the bloodstream.

Q: What are the general expectations for a person using Respibien for the first time?

A: Official information indicates that users can generally expect the medicine to begin working quickly, often within minutes, with effects lasting up to 12 hours. Common first-time expectations should include the possibility of temporary local effects such as stinging, burning, or irritation in the nose.

Q: Does the efficacy of Respibien change with continuous use?

A: Yes, information on the medicine’s mechanism of action states that continuous use can lead to tachyphylaxis, which is a technical term for reduced effectiveness. This means the medicine may be associated with becoming less effective over time due to the continuous activation of blood vessel receptors.

Q: Is there a generic version of Respibien available?

A: Respibien is a brand name, but its active ingredient is Oxymetazoline, which is the generic name for the compound. Because Oxymetazoline nasal solution is an established product, generic equivalents containing the same active ingredient are available from various manufacturers.

How should Respibien be stored and disposed of?

Respibien (Oxymetazoline nasal solution) must be stored and disposed of according to official regulatory labeling to ensure stability and safety.

Storage Requirements

Condition Requirement
Temperature Store at room temperature, typically 20 C to 25 C (68 F to 77 F). Protect from excessive heat and freezing [DailyMed].
Protection Keep in the container it came in, tightly closed, away from excess moisture and direct light [MedlinePlus].
Child Safety Keep out of the sight and reach of children due to the risk of serious events if accidentally ingested [FDA].
Container Rule Do not share the dispenser with anyone else to prevent the spread of infection [MedlinePlus].

Disposal Instructions

The product must not be kept if outdated or no longer needed. Do not dispose of the medication in household trash or wastewater without following specific procedures [Mayo Clinic]. Patients should consult a pharmacist or health care provider for instructions on the proper and safe disposal of unused or expired medicine [Cleveland Clinic].
